Meaning of 贬值

贬值 means to depreciate; to lose purchasing power (of currency); to devalue; to lower the official exchange rate (of a currency). Pronounced biǎn zhí. HSK 7-9.

  • to depreciate; to lose purchasing power (of currency)
  • to devalue; to lower the official exchange rate (of a currency)
  • to decrease in value; to be devalued (of things in general)
